How they compare

Equatorial Guinea currently reports 5.81 % change on previous year against 5 % change on previous year in Kuwait, a difference of 0.81 % change on previous year.

That makes Equatorial Guinea's figure about 1.2 times Kuwait's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 21 shared years of data; in 1986 it was Equatorial Guinea ahead.

Equatorial Guinea ranks 113th and Kuwait ranks 114th of 162 countries.

Equatorial Guinea has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Equatorial Guinea Kuwait Difference Ahead
1980s 2.71 % change on previous year -1.22 % change on previous year 3.93 % change on previous year Equatorial Guinea
1990s 43.2 % change on previous year 1.99 % change on previous year 41.21 % change on previous year Equatorial Guinea
2000s 38.84 % change on previous year 13.88 % change on previous year 24.96 % change on previous year Equatorial Guinea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
